## Launch Plan: Solvane Pro (Managers Only)

Heads of department: Solvane Pro launches in the Vettering market on a phased basis. Marketing assets clear legal review this week; fulfilment capacity is confirmed through the Dunbray warehouse. Support staffing doubles for the first month. Hold all external communication until the embargo lifts. The business rationale driving these choices is captured in the confidential note below.

management briefing: The renewal with Zoraelax Group closes at $10 million a year, 15 percent below the last contract. Project Ralael slips by six weeks because of the audit delay.

## Retrying Failed Exports

When a Tidefall export job fails, do not immediately re-submit it. First check the job's terminal status: `FAILED_TRANSIENT` jobs are safe to retry with the same payload, while `FAILED_VALIDATION` jobs will fail again until the manifest is corrected. Plugins should implement exponential backoff starting at 30 seconds, capped at five attempts, and must preserve the original idempotency token across retries. Full retry semantics, error codes, and idempotency rules for plugin authors are documented here:

operations page: https://jenkins.zemvarcloud.local/job/merge_requests/repo/build/73930b4b30f0a8ed

## tailctl — log tailing CLI

Maintained by the Obscura platform team. `tailctl` streams service logs from the Lanternwood cluster. Flags mirror grep semantics; defaults to last 500 lines. Config lives in `~/.tailctl.yaml`. Do not add features without updating the smoke tests. Full command reference and escalation notes live on the internal wiki page here:

operations page: https://jira.qorvelsys.internal/browse/pages/browse/pages